Meet Bahianita, the tall display font with a rustic Brazilian soul.

Engineered by the Omnibus-Type foundry, Bahianita is a single-weight display typeface that distills the kinetic energy of Brazilian vernacular lettering into a rigid yet rustic digital framework. Characterized by its extreme verticality and condensed proportions, this font employs a hand-carved aesthetic reminiscent of woodcut techniques, featuring idiosyncratic terminals and a high x-height that maximizes legibility in tight vertical compositions. Its rhythmic ductus reflects a specific regional soul from Bahia, optimized for modern screen rendering while maintaining the organic imperfections of its source material, making it a specialized tool for high-impact headlines requiring a distinct linguistic and cultural resonance within the Latin character set.

Bahianita Font Frequently Asked Questions

What design styles best suit the Bahianita font family?

Bahianita excels in rustic, hand-crafted, or tropical design themes that require a touch of organic warmth and cultural personality. Its woodcut-inspired aesthetic thrives in woodblock print simulations, where its irregular x-heights and glyph terminations mimic traditional manual carving techniques.

Is Bahianita effective for large-scale headline use?

This font is highly effective for headlines because its bold, condensed letterforms command attention without consuming excessive horizontal space. The high stroke-to-counter ratio ensures that display-sized characters maintain strong visual density, optimizing the ink trap performance in large-format printing.

How does Bahianita perform in long-form body text?

Bahianita is generally not recommended for long-form body text due to its condensed nature and irregular rhythm which can fatigue the eye. The narrow aperture and tight tracking lead to visual "rivers" in justified blocks, significantly reducing the reading speed in paragraphs exceeding fifty words.

What font categories pair most effectively with Bahianita?

It pairs most effectively with neutral, geometric sans-serifs or clean monospaced fonts that provide a stable structural contrast to its expressive nature. Establishing a typographic hierarchy with low-stroke-contrast fonts like Roboto or Montserrat offsets Bahianita's expressive, vertical terminal angles.

Is Bahianita legible at very small point sizes?

Legibility suffers at very small point sizes because the tight counters and condensed proportions cause letters to blur together into a singular mass. Sub-8pt rendering often results in glyph collision where the ascenders and descenders lose their distinctive geometric silhouettes on standard 72ppi displays.
